Ошибка компиляции «ожидается идентификатор» в программе Excel является достаточно распространенной проблемой, которую могут столкнуться пользователи при создании макросов или пользовательских функций. Такая ошибка возникает, когда компилятор не может распознать идентификатор или переменную, используемую в коде.
Причины возникновения этой ошибки могут быть различными. Одной из возможных причин является отсутствие или неправильное использование ключевых слов, функций или переменных в коде. Некорректные ссылки на ячейки или неправильный синтаксис могут также привести к данной ошибке.
Одним из способов решения этой проблемы является правильное написание кода, устранение опечаток и проверка синтаксических ошибок. Также следует убедиться, что все переменные и идентификаторы корректно объявлены и используются в соответствии с требованиями программы Excel.
Для более сложных случаев можно воспользоваться функцией отладки, чтобы выявить и исправить ошибку. Программа Excel предоставляет различные инструменты, такие как отладчик и режим отображения значений переменных, которые помогут в поиске и устранении ошибок компиляции.
Итак, ошибка компиляции «ожидается идентификатор» может возникать по разным причинам, но в основе ее решения лежит тщательная проверка кода и устранение синтаксических ошибок. Это важный этап разработки макросов и пользовательских функций в Excel, поскольку правильно написанный код гарантирует его безошибочное выполнение.
Ошибка компиляции: идентификатор Excel
Ошибка компиляции «ожидается идентификатор Excel» часто возникает при работе с макросами и VBA в Excel. Эта ошибка указывает на то, что компилятор не может распознать использованный идентификатор или переменную в коде. Проблема может проявиться в различных сценариях, таких как неправильное обращение к объектам Excel, неверное использование синтаксиса или отсутствие объявления переменной.
Существует несколько причин возникновения этой ошибки:
1. Отсутствие объявления переменной: Если вы используете переменную в коде, но не объявили ее заранее, компилятор не сможет понять, что это за идентификатор. В таком случае, необходимо добавить объявление переменной перед ее использованием.
2. Неправильное обращение к объектам Excel: Если в коде есть обращение к объектам Excel, таким как листы, ячейки или диапазоны, и они указаны неправильно, это может вызывать ошибку «ожидается идентификатор Excel». Проверьте, что вы правильно обратились к нужному объекту и исправьте ошибку по необходимости.
3. Неверное использование синтаксиса: Ошибка компиляции может возникнуть из-за неправильного использования синтаксиса языка VBA. Убедитесь, что вы используете правильные операторы, ключевые слова и закрытие скобок в своем коде. Проверьте код на наличие синтаксических ошибок и исправьте их.
Если вы столкнулись с ошибкой компиляции «ожидается идентификатор Excel», вот несколько способов ее решения:
1. Объявление переменных: Убедитесь, что все используемые переменные в вашем коде объявлены заранее. Добавьте объявление переменной перед ее использованием.
2. Проверьте правильность обращения: Проверьте все обращения к объектам Excel в вашем коде и убедитесь, что они указаны правильно. Проверьте имена листов, ячеек и диапазонов, а также правильность использования точек и скобок.
3. Исправьте синтаксические ошибки: Внимательно просмотрите свой код и исправьте все синтаксические ошибки. Убедитесь, что вы правильно используете операторы, ключевые слова и закрытие скобок.
Следуя указанным выше способам решения, вы сможете исправить ошибку компиляции «ожидается идентификатор Excel» и успешно продолжить работу с макросами и VBA в Excel.